1.1 The AI Revolution in Healthcare

In the realm of healthcare, AI is making waves by designing antibodies for diseases, revolutionizing medical diagnostics and treatments. The projected investment of $150 billion by 2026 speaks volumes about the importance of AI for this sector.

1.2 Digging Better with AI in the Mining Industry

The mining industry is leveraging AI to improve operational efficiency and data processing, leading to a significant boost in productivity and safety.

1.3 AI in the Banking Sector: A Golden Ticket

The banking sector is also cashing in on the AI boom, harnessing its power for fraud detection, personalization, and regulatory compliance. The sector is poised to be a front-runner in AI investments by 2024.

2.1 Accounting: Balancing the Books with AI

AI is streamlining accounting procedures, driving efficiency, and offering competitive advantages. Its booming market is projected to reach staggering heights of $161.8 million by 2028.

2.2 AI: Constructing a Better Future

In the construction industry, AI is playing a pivotal role in planning, building, and monitoring, leading to a potential productivity increase of around 50%.

2.3 Retail: Personalizing Shopping Experiences with AI

The retail sector is capitalizing on AI's potential for hyperpersonalization and customer loyalty. The AI market in retail is expected to reach an impressive $20.05 billion by 2026.

3. Deciphering the Impact of AI on the Future of Work

The AI ripple effect is extending to the job market, with projections of replacing 16% of jobs while creating 9% of new jobs in the US by 2025. It poses a clear challenge to job activities, yet it seems less likely to replace tasks involving managerial skills and stakeholder interactions.
